This book delves into the evolving relationship between Georgia and the European Union, focusing on developments up to 2023. The grant of EU candidate status to Georgia in December 2023 was a key milestone. Yet, internal challenges, including a controversial foreign agent law, have cast uncertainty on its path to full membership.The Association Agreement with the EU is expected to bring significant economic benefits, such as improved export opportunities and the growth of joint ventures. However, obstacles like financial constraints, competition, and infrastructural issues must be addressed through effective coordination and support systems.While Georgia's exports to the EU have seen a modest increase, the country has yet to undergo a structural economic transformation. Emphasizing industrialisation over-dependence on tourism and foreign direct investment is crucial for long-term growth.Georgia's rich history of EU engagement places it at a pivotal juncture, ready to leverage its proximity to the EU for modernisation and economic advancement. This examination provides insights into navigating the complexities of EU integration and unlocking future opportunities for Georgia.
